Replacing the projection lamp

WARNING:

To avoid burns, allow the projector to cool for at least 30 minutes before you open the lamp-module door. Never remove the lamp module while the lamp is operating.

The lamp-hour counter in the Status menu counts the number of hours the lamp has been in use. After 1980 hours of use, the message Change Lamptemporarily appears on the screen when the projector is turned on. Change the lamp within 20 hours. After 2000 hours, the LED flashes orange and the lamp will not light. Replace the lamp when the brightness is no longer acceptable. You can order new lamp modules from your dealer. See Appendix A for more details.

Follow these steps to replace the projection lamp:

1.Turn off the projector by unplugging the power cord.

2.Wait 30 minutes to allow the projector to cool thoroughly.

3.Invert the projector on a soft, flat surface, and then insert a small screwdriver or other flat object into the tab on the lamp-module door.
